Subject: Static-analysis baseline — read before your first review

Welcome to the Pintlewick rotation. Quick note: the scanner compares against a checked-in baseline file, so old findings are suppressed and only new ones block merges. Do not let anyone regenerate the baseline to hide fresh issues — that needs sign-off from the Corvass platform team. Shrinking the baseline is always fine; growing it is not. Handling steps are on the page below.

operations page: https://jenkins.zemvarcloud.local/job/merge_requests/repo/build/73930b4b30f0a8ed

Ticket #—Facilities request: Goods lift, Tamsen Building. The goods lift is reserved for deliveries between 07:00 and 11:00 daily; reception staff must not release it for passenger use during this window. If couriers arrive outside these hours, log the delivery and direct them to the loading dock. The override panel beside the lift requires the code below.

turnstile pass: bdg-QZV-3

Subject: Payments cut-over complete — flaky tests quarantined

Team, the Ledgerfin payments service cut-over finished at 06:40. The flaky integration tests that blocked the last two releases have been quarantined into a separate suite, so green builds now reflect actual service health. No customer-facing changes. If a ticket mentions payment retries or webhook delays, check the quarantined suite first. For reference, the service is currently running with these configuration values:

service settings:
[eliax]
port = 6379
region = lower-4
host = eliax.paliqlabs.corp
timeout_ms = 750
retries = 3